A recording of a theater performance by the Brno City Theater from 2010. On the morning before his wedding, Bill wakes up in bed after a night he doesn't remember, with a girl he doesn't remember, and he doesn't even remember what happened between them. And the girl says a lot. There is nothing left to do but immediately hide her in the bathroom and, with the generous help of best man Tom and poor maid Julie, who accidentally got involved, try to keep everything secret from the bride and her mother, while the joyfully drinking father begins to cause slight complications for the hotel staff. Everything gets even more complicated when Tom finds out which girl spent the night with Bill.
